GREER

GREER is a Texas oil lease in Harrison County, Railroad Commission district 06, operated by Allen Brothers Company. It has 3 wellbores on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to August 2026, totalling 25,659 barrels.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$343K, with roughly $66K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 100 barrels a month, about 33 per wellbore. Its strongest month on the record we hold was November 2024, at 195 barrels.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 45%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

How much is GREER worth?
The remaining production from GREER is estimated to be worth about $343K in total as of 26 August 2026, within a range of $189K to $497K.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in GREER is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production GREER has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for GREER is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
